#c2ace2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c2ace2 is composed of 76.1% red, 67.5%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.2%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 264.4 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 78%. #c2ace2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8559c5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#c2ace2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c2ace2 has RGB values of R:194, G:172,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 12758242.

Shades and Tints of #c2ace2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030104 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c2ace2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c7c6c8 is the less saturated color, while #bd92fc is the most saturated one.
